The Role of Second-hand Markets in Democratizing Sustainable Fashion for Women

Second-hand and vintage markets play a crucial role in making sustainable fashion more accessible to women across different socio-economic backgrounds. These markets provide affordable and unique options, allowing women to participate in sustainable consumption regardless of their financial status. However, the reliance on second-hand markets also highlights the need for direct sustainable production that is both affordable and inclusive.
